Hamstead Social - Focus Birmingham
Hamstead Social is a social group for adults living with a visual impairment in Birmingham. The group gives service users a chance to meet new people, access peer support and take part in activities such as seated exercise, quizzes and guest speakers. Starting on January 2024, the group will meet every Friday from 10am – 12pm at Spring Housing Association. There is a cost of £2 per person per session. Spring 22 Community Hub has level access from the main entrance to the meeting room as well as accessible toilets. The venue is near to Hamstead train station and the 16 and 54 bus stops.
